1 errata ? releasing reset condition without clock reset during eeprom write serial programming at voltages below 2.9 volts 3. releasing reset condition without clock if an external reset or a watchdog reset occurs while the clock is stopped and the reset is released before the clock is restarted, the internal reset will time out after the start-up delay, which is independent of the external clock. if no external clock pulses are present in the period when internal reset is active, the reset does cor- rectly cause tri-stating of the i/o while the reset is held. however, if the internal reset is relesed before the clock starts running, the part does not clear its i/o reg- isters, nor set pc to 0x00. here, stopping the clock refers to gating the external clock input. power-down mode does not have this issue. problem fix/workaround make sure the clock is running whenever an external reset can be expected. if the watchdog is used, never stop an external clock. 2. reset during eeprom write if reset is activated during eeprom write, the result is not what should be expected. the eeprom write cycle completes as normal, but the address regis- ters are reset to 0. the result is that both the address written and address 0 in the eeprom can be corrupted. problem fix/workaround avoid using address 0 for storage, unless you can guarantee that you will not get a reset during eeprom write. 1. serial programming at voltages below 2.9 volts at voltages below 2.9 volts, serial programming might fail. problem fix/workaround keep v cc at 2.9 volts or higher during in-system programming. 8-bit microcontroller with 1k byte in-system programmable flash at90s1200/a rev. f errata sheet rev. 1190d?09/01
